Math 40: Arithmetic
- Course Description
- Math 40 is a review of addition, subtraction, multiplication and division of whole numbers, fractions,
decimals and integers. Other topics include: ratios and proportions, percentages, applications, order of
operations, and a focus on problem solving and math success skills.
- Who should take this course?
- Generally, students place into Math 40 via the Accuplacer placement test. Students who complete this
course usually go on to take Math 60 (although students in some programs may opt to
take Business 130).
- Is this course transferable?
- This course does not transfer to a four-year university such as the University of Washington.
- When is this course offered?
- Math 40 is offered each quarter, including Summer Quarter. Math 40 is taught by instructors in the
Developmental Education division. Math 40 is also offered in the Math Center.
